What is the first step when treating a patient with a suspected spinal injury?
✔✔ Keep the patient still, support their head and neck, and call for emergency help.
How do you assess circulation in a limb with a suspected fracture?
✔✔ Check for a pulse, skin color, and temperature below the injury site.
What should you do if a patient has an open chest wound?
✔✔ Cover it with a non-porous dressing, taped on three sides, and monitor their breathing.
How do you treat a patient with a chemical burn to the skin?
✔✔ Flush the area with running water for at least 20 minutes and remove contaminated clothing.
What is the most effective way to treat a dislocated shoulder in the field?
✔✔ Immobilize the joint in the position found and seek immediate medical help.

✔✔ Keep them lying down, monitor for shock, and get emergency medical assistance.
What should you do if a patient has a flail chest?
✔✔ Stabilize the injured area with a bulky dressing and monitor for respiratory distress.
How do you assist someone with a penetrating abdominal injury?
✔✔ Cover the wound with a sterile, non-adherent dressing and avoid applying direct pressure.
What is the proper way to remove an impaled object from a wound?
✔✔ Do not remove it—stabilize it with dressings and seek emergency medical care.
How do you manage a patient experiencing severe hypothermia?
✔✔ Move them to a warm area, remove wet clothing, insulate them, and provide warm fluids if
conscious.
What should you do if a patient has been electrocuted and is unresponsive?
✔✔ Ensure the scene is safe, call for emergency help, and begin CPR if necessary.
